Shane Vendrell is one of the most complex characters ever constructed. An absolute testament to Walton Goggins as a brilliant actor. In juxtaposition, Vic is ultimately and completely "one-sided"..... This scene, above any other, shows Shane in his most vulnerable form. You see that his wife hates him, he hates himself, and (as an actor) he knows the audience hates him. But after this, he has some self-redemption; his wife embraces him again; and us as an audience can sympathize...
